#194685 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#194685 is composed of 9.8% red, 27.5%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.2% cyan, 47.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 215 degrees, a saturation of 68.4% and a lightness of 31%. #194685 color hex could be obtained by blending #328cff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#194685
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#eff5f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#194685
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a4e54 is the less saturated color, while #01429d is the most saturated one.
